Job Description for WordPress Developer for M4AFoundation



Reporting to the Meta volunteer of the Technical Team, the WordPress Developer is an integral part in the success of Match4Action. The WordPress Developer will help update a website/web portal by helping to understand current site functionality and plan, execute the build, test and delivery of the new site/portal.



Responsibilities



Work with the Technology and Business teams to update/build the assigned website/web portal

Interacts with the business analysis team to understand project requirements

Develops overall architecture/product design documents, technical design specifications for individual modules and technology justifications for architectural considerations

Re-design site architecture to incorporate, default and custom WordPress templates, specifically AVADA Theme Fusion and Ninja Forms plugin customizing PHP code, CSS, JavaScript and build custom components

Execute all visual design stages from concept to construction.

Customize the site to track project progress updates and analytics effectively.

Ensure integration of entire system or subsystem

Provide maintenance and troubleshooting support to the helpdesk and/ or maintenance team to help resolve technical issues with production systems by debugging, research and investigation.

Develop using PHP code where necessary using appropriate frameworks. Develop secure web services. And integrate APIs, third-party tools as required

Create PL/SQL procedures, functions, triggers and associated PL/ SQL or SQL database scripts as needed.

Applies standard coding practices and industry standards



Skills/Qualification Preferred



Good understanding of front-end technologies, including HTML5, CSS3, JavaScript, jQuery

Experience building user interfaces for websites and/or web applications using WordPress CMS and related themes and plugins for 2+ years.

Experience designing and developing responsive design websites

Ability to understand CSS changes and their ramifications to ensure consistent style across platforms and browsers

Ability to convert comprehensive layout and wireframes into working web pages

Knowledge of how to interact with RESTful APIs and formats (JSON, XML)

Proficient understanding of code versioning tools {{such as Git, SVN, and Mercurial}}

Strong understanding of PHP back-end development

Effective communication skills; listening, written and verbal; ability to communicate complex concepts to both technical and non-technical team members
